We are currently booked for 10 nights in a studio at old key west. It is my DH's favorite. He LOVES it there. It is where we all feel at home. We have stayed at Jambo house (villas and reg room) 4 other times but never kadani. I am thinking of doing a split stay. 5 nights at kadani and 5 at okw. They have a savanah view available.

The problem is that twice we had booked savanah view at Jambo and got a view of an empty savannah. It is now on our list of don't bother. However DD (6) and I love animals and I have heard better things about Kadani. I need some serious help in convincing DH to do this and be happy about it.

The split stay would be nessesary because my parents are meeting us at OKW halfway through the trip.

Split stay is what we're doing; 7 nights at OKW, 2 at Kidani. But if you are going to be there 10 nights you could do an 8/2 split in order to have full mouse service instead of towel service after 4 nights at OKW
 
We just did 5 and 5 at OKW and Kidani in June. OKW was nice, but Kidani was awesome. Loved the covered parking and the pool area. We also really liked the remoteness of it too. It felt like going back to the bat cave every night, off the beaten trail in it's own little corner. :)
